Amazon.com Product Description The Casio Digital women's watch is a basic, durable, water-resistant timepiece constructed without unnecessary buttons or frills, making it the perfect accessory for no-nonsense women. The watch includes a resin case, bezel, and matching band, and features a mineral dial window that protects the simple black dial face. The face features a quartz-powered digital time display, as well as a perpetual calendar.

Had one of these watches for years January 7, 2009 Genealogist (Clarkston, WA) Casio Women's Daily Alarm Digital Watch #LA11WB-1 This watch is a good "work horse." I have had 3 or 4 over the years. Yes, they finally do wear out, but not until about 5-6 years. They are great for timing things for 1, 3, 5, 10, 15, 20, or 30 minutes. The battery will last longer than one year. I take my watch to a small local jewelry store in the town where I live for replacement of the battery. I wear my watch 24/7. It is not an "elegant" watch to wear when you are dressed to "go out on the town." I am not a "clothes horse" person and thus this does not matter to me. Most of the time I purchase an expandable watch band for this watch. The down side of this watch is the "belt and buckle" watch band. It takes me a bit longer to put on my wrist due to my arthritis and thus I prefer an expandable metal watch band.

Great watch December 4, 2008 Laura Hughes (Champaign, IL) I have had this style of watch for about 15 years. It is a cheap watch and looks kind of cheap too, however it has one really great feature. You can set the little timer for 1,3,5,10,15,20 and 30 minutes. It is great for doing the laundry, or leaving the kitchen timer and going somewhere in the house but still knowing when the timer should go off. I use it when I only want to spend so much time doing something and the timer reminds me to stop or start the next thing. I love it!!!
